Local baby contracts Georgia’s first measles case of 2026

SAVANNAH, Ga. (WTOC) – The Georgia Department of Public Health (DPH) has confirmed a measles case in a baby who lives in the Coastal Health District.

The Coastal Health District encompasses the seven counties of Bryan, Camden, Chatham, Effingham, Glynn, Liberty, Long and McIntosh.

In a press release, the Georgia DPH said the baby caught the virus while traveling internationally, and was too young to receive a routine measles vaccination…
